The Basics of Fractions, Decimals, and Percentages
Before diving into the specifics of converting 1/8 into a percentage, let’s establish a clear understanding of the basic concepts of fractions, decimals, and percentages and how they interrelate. Each represents a different way of expressing a part of a whole, and knowing how to convert between them is essential for numerical literacy.
A fraction represents a part of a whole. In real terms, it consists of two numbers: the numerator (the top number) and the denominator (the bottom number). That's why the numerator indicates how many parts of the whole you have, while the denominator indicates the total number of parts the whole is divided into. To give you an idea, in the fraction 1/8, 1 is the numerator, and 8 is the denominator Simple as that..
A decimal is another way to represent a part of a whole, using a base-10 system. A percentage is a way of expressing a number as a fraction of 100. The word "percent" means "per hundred." So, when we say 50%, we mean 50 out of 100, or 50/100. Percentages are widely used to express proportions, rates, and changes in a standardized way that is easy to understand and compare. Converting a number to a percentage involves multiplying it by 100.
The relationship between these concepts is fundamental. A fraction can be converted into a decimal by dividing the numerator by the denominator. Here's one way to look at it: to convert 1/2 to a decimal, you divide 1 by 2, resulting in 0.5. Once you have the decimal, you can convert it to a percentage by multiplying by 100. Step-by-Step Conversion of 1/8 to a Percentage
Converting 1/8 to a percentage is a straightforward process that involves two simple steps: converting the fraction to a decimal and then converting the decimal to a percentage. Let's break down each step in detail And that's really what it comes down to..
Step 1: Convert the Fraction to a Decimal
To convert the fraction 1/8 to a decimal, you need to divide the numerator (1) by the denominator (8). This is a basic division operation that can be performed manually or using a calculator.
1 ÷ 8 = 0.125
So, the fraction 1/8 is equivalent to the decimal 0.125. So in practice, one-eighth of a whole is equal to one hundred twenty-five thousandths.
Step 2: Convert the Decimal to a Percentage
Once you have the decimal, converting it to a percentage is simple. To do this, multiply the decimal by 100. This moves the decimal point two places to the right, effectively expressing the number as a portion of 100 Less friction, more output..

Using Benchmarks and Proportions:
Another approach involves using benchmark fractions and percentages that are commonly known. Here's one way to look at it: it is well-known that 1/4 is equal to 25%. Since 1/8 is half of 1/4, we can simply take half of 25% to find the percentage equivalent of 1/8.
25% ÷ 2 = 12.5%
This method is useful when the fraction in question is a multiple or a fraction of a commonly known fraction. It relies on understanding proportional relationships and can be a quick mental calculation No workaround needed..

Avoid Percentage Point Confusion:
When discussing changes in percentages, it helps to distinguish between percentage changes and percentage point changes. A percentage change refers to the relative change in a value, while a percentage point change refers to the absolute difference between two percentages.
Here's one way to look at it: if an interest rate increases from 5% to 7%, it has increased by 2 percentage points. Still, the percentage change is calculated as ((7-5)/5) * 100 = 40%. So, the interest rate has increased by 2 percentage points or 40%. Confusing these two concepts can lead to misinterpretations and misunderstandings.

Q: What is the difference between a percentage and a ratio?
A percentage is a way of expressing a number as a fraction of 100, while a ratio is a comparison of two or more quantities. Percentages are often used to express proportions or rates, while ratios are used to compare the relative sizes of different categories. To give you an idea, if a class has 20 students and 12 are female, the percentage of female students is (12/20) * 100 = 60%, while the ratio of female to male students is 12:8, which can be simplified to 3:2.
Q: How do I calculate the percentage increase or decrease between two values?
To calculate the percentage increase or decrease between two values, use the formula: ((New Value - Old Value) / Old Value) * 100. If the result is positive, it represents a percentage increase. If the result is negative, it represents a percentage decrease. To give you an idea, if a stock price increases from $50 to $60, the percentage increase is ((60-50)/50) * 100 = 20% Worth keeping that in mind..
